Pricing factors to consider
Customers often want to know what affects the cost of a man and van service. While exact prices depend on the provider and the job, several practical factors usually influence the quote. Understanding these helps you compare options sensibly and avoids surprises later on. It also helps you decide whether your job is best suited to a simple van move or whether you may need additional help.
Key factors often include the size and weight of the load, the distance between pickup and drop-off points, the time required for loading and unloading, and how easy it is to access the properties. Stairs, long carrying distances, or difficult parking can all affect the amount of time needed. Some jobs are straightforward point-to-point deliveries, while others require more planning because of property type or item complexity.
Timing can matter as well. A same-day request, weekend booking, or a move at a busy time of day may need extra coordination. If you are trying to keep your costs sensible, the most helpful thing you can do is provide accurate details from the start. That allows the service to quote in a way that reflects the job properly, rather than estimating from incomplete information.

How to prepare for moving day
Good preparation can make a big difference, especially in a busy area like Harringay. Even a smaller move can feel tiring if boxes are not packed properly or if the route from the property to the van is blocked by clutter. A little organisation beforehand helps the loading process run more smoothly and protects your belongings.
Start by separating items into what needs to go, what can be donated, and what should stay with you. Pack smaller items securely and avoid overfilling boxes, especially if they will be lifted up stairs. Dismantling large furniture where practical can also help, though it is worth keeping screws, fittings, and small parts together in a clearly marked bag. If you have fragile items, make those easy to identify before the move begins.
It is also wise to think about access. Are there any entry codes, door buzzers, shared gates, or building rules the driver should know about? Is there a better place to park or a specific loading point nearby? Will someone need to be at the pickup property to hand over keys or oversee access? These details may sound small, but they can make the difference between a smooth move and an avoidable delay.

Frequently asked questions
Do I need a full removal service for a small flat move?
Not always. Many small moves are better suited to a van service, especially if you have a limited amount of furniture and boxes. If your move is local and does not require a large team, a man and van option can be a sensible and cost-effective choice.
Can you help with just one item?
Yes, many customers book a van for a single large item such as a sofa, wardrobe, bed, fridge, or washing machine. Single-item moves are common, particularly when an item is too big for a car or needs more careful handling than a standard delivery.
What if my property has difficult access?
That is common in Harringay and surrounding areas. Narrow hallways, upper-floor flats, stairs, and limited parking are all normal issues for local moves. The best approach is to mention these details in advance so the job can be planned properly.
Can you do same-day or short-notice jobs?
Sometimes, depending on availability. Many customers need a quick collection or urgent transport, and a local van service is often a good choice for those situations. If you need a same-day job, it is best to enquire as early as possible.
Do you help with loading and unloading?
Often yes, though the level of help should be confirmed when you book. Some jobs only require transport, while others need lifting support. If you have heavy furniture or boxed items, mention that early so the right arrangement can be made.
What should I do before the move?
Pack and label boxes, make sure large items are ready, and check access details for the property. If you want to make the day easier, keep key documents, valuables, and essentials separate so they do not get mixed in with the main load.
